Cremation in New Jersey
New Jersey has some of the highest cremation costs in the nation due to its high cost of living and regulatory requirements. Newark, Jersey City, and Trenton offer the most provider options.
New Jersey Cremation Laws
New Jersey requires a 48-hour waiting period and mandates that a licensed funeral director handle all cremation arrangements. A permit from the local registrar is also required.
Money-Saving Tip
New Jersey prices are significantly higher near New York City. Providers in South Jersey or Central Jersey typically charge $500-$1,500 less than those in the northern part of the state.

What is the difference between cremation and burial costs in Blackwood?
Cremation is significantly less expensive than traditional burial in Blackwood. Direct cremation starts at $2,940, while a traditional burial with casket, vault, and cemetery plot typically costs $7,000–$12,000 or more. Cremation also eliminates ongoing cemetery maintenance fees.
How long does the cremation process take in Blackwood?
In New Jersey, the entire cremation process typically takes 3–5 business days from when the funeral home receives the remains. This includes obtaining required permits and death certificates. The cremation itself takes 2–3 hours.
Do I need to buy an urn from the cremation provider?
No. Under the FTC Funeral Rule, cremation providers cannot require you to buy an urn from them. They must return ashes in a basic container at no extra charge. You can purchase an urn separately from any retailer, often at a lower price.
What happens to the ashes after cremation?
After cremation in Blackwood, the ashes (cremated remains) are returned to the family in an urn or basic container. Families can keep them at home, scatter them in a meaningful location (following local regulations), place them in a columbarium, or bury them in a cemetery.
